One of the best exposés I've seen that reveals this policy of appointing a sacrificial goat out of one's own flock is the book Scapegoat for an Empire by Lieutenant George Witton. Lieut. Witton was an Australian national serving in the British Forces in South Africa. Scapegoat of an Empire was made into one of the best films that ever graced the silver screen, an Australian masterpiece entitled Breaker Morant. The true story is a simple one: Three Australians are ordered into battle during the Boer (Farmer's War) that pitted the British against the Dutch Africaans. When the British policies are disclosed, they blame their own men, who conveniently happen to be the Australians and not the English. Three Australians are tried and found guilty.

 

Witton is pardoned while the other two meet their maker at the wrong end of a firing squad. Witton returns to Australia and writes his book about one-sided British policies. One of the two executed men is Lieut. Harry Morant, who was known as "The Breaker" for his skill at taming wild horses.
